Jogging routes around Saint-Didier-Sous-Riverie offer a diverse natural environment within the "coteaux du Lyonnais" (hills of Lyon). The region features a mix of rolling hills, open countryside, agricultural landscapes, and forests, providing varied terrain for runners. These natural features contribute to engaging routes, ranging from gentle slopes to more challenging ascents, often winding through rural areas and small villages. Panoramic views of the Lyonnaise region, the Alps, and Mont Pilat are accessible from various high points.

The Signal site, an emblematic highest point in the Monts du Lyonnais, located at 934 meters, equipped with a belvedere and an orientation table.

Interesting is the Cassini terminal, where the first surveys were carried out in 1758 to draw up the map of Lyon, a moment in history.

The highest point of the Monts du Lyonnais, the Signal du Saint-André site has been fitted out with a belvedere and an orientation table. The viewpoint offers a 180 degree panorama over the Rhone Valley and the Alps when the weather is clear.

The highest point of the MDL is the Crêt Malherbe with an altitude of 946m against 934m for the Signal de Saint-André

Frequently Asked Questions

How many running routes are available around Saint-Didier-Sous-Riverie?

There are over 260 running routes around Saint-Didier-Sous-Riverie, offering a wide variety of options for different fitness levels and preferences. The komoot community has explored more than 5000 of these routes.

What kind of terrain can I expect on the jogging trails in this region?

The region around Saint-Didier-Sous-Riverie is characterized by a diverse mix of rolling hills, open countryside, agricultural landscapes, and forests. You'll find routes with gentle slopes as well as more challenging ascents, often winding through rural areas and small villages. Many routes feature mostly paved surfaces, providing a consistent running experience.

Are there any easy or beginner-friendly running routes in Saint-Didier-Sous-Riverie?

Yes, there are 16 easy running routes available, perfect for beginners or those looking for a more relaxed jog. Additionally, there are 167 moderate routes that offer a good balance of challenge and accessibility.

What are some notable landmarks or scenic views I can enjoy while running?

The area offers breathtaking visual rewards. High points provide spectacular panoramic views of the Lyonnaise region, the majestic Alps, and Mont Pilat. You might also encounter historical sites like the 11th-century Romanesque Chapel Saint-Vincent, or natural features such as the Prairies and Heathlands of Montagny or Le Signal de Saint André.

Are there any circular running routes available?

Yes, many of the running routes in the area are circular, allowing you to start and finish at the same point. For example, the Petit Châtelard loop from Sainte-Catherine is a moderate 11.8 km route, and the Running loop from Chabanière is a 10.6 km moderate option.

Can I find running routes that pass by lakes or water features?

Yes, some routes are near water features. The Thurins Dam offers a calm loop for walking or light jogging, complete with picnic areas. Other nearby lakes include Lac de la Madone and Plan d'Eau de la Combe Gibert.

What do other runners say about the trails in Saint-Didier-Sous-Riverie?

The running routes in Saint-Didier-Sous-Riverie are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.4 stars from over 230 reviews. Runners often praise the diverse natural landscapes, the tranquility of the rural setting, and the inspiring panoramic views of the Lyonnaise region and the Alps.

Are the running trails in Saint-Didier-Sous-Riverie suitable for families?

While specific family-friendly routes are not explicitly highlighted, the presence of 16 easy routes and numerous moderate paths through tranquil rural areas suggests that many trails could be suitable for families, depending on the children's age and fitness level. The varied terrain and scenic views offer an engaging experience for all.

Is there parking available near the trailheads?

The region is well-suited for outdoor activities, and many routes start from villages or accessible points. While specific parking locations aren't detailed for every route, it's generally possible to find parking in or near the small villages that serve as starting points for these trails.

What is the typical length and duration of running routes in the area?

Running routes vary significantly in length and duration. You can find shorter, moderate routes like the Ravito 2 loop from Sainte-Catherine, which is 8.7 km and takes about 1 hour 5 minutes. Longer, more challenging options, such as the Ravito 2 loop from Les Farges, cover 19.7 km and can take over 2 hours 30 minutes.

Are there any challenging running routes with significant elevation gain?

Yes, for runners seeking a challenge, there are 86 difficult routes. The Le Signal loop from Les Farges, for instance, is a difficult 14.3 km path with substantial elevation changes, offering panoramic views across the Lyonnaise region and Mont Pilat.

What is the best time of year to go running in Saint-Didier-Sous-Riverie?

The region's diverse landscapes make it appealing throughout much of the year. Spring and autumn generally offer pleasant temperatures and beautiful scenery with changing foliage. Summer can be warm, so early morning or late afternoon runs are often preferred. Winter runs are possible, but checking local conditions for ice or snow is advisable, especially on higher trails.
